Transaction 6621157dd43e7714bf62c936ee8a60c5c17236ca2180e4af27b3a8b984d1677a

1 Input
2 Outputs
  • 6621157dd43e7714bf62c936ee8a60c5c17236ca2180e4af27b3a8b984d1677a:0
  • value  1600
    address  2N8hwP1WmJrFF5QWABn38y63uYLhnJYJYTF
  • 6621157dd43e7714bf62c936ee8a60c5c17236ca2180e4af27b3a8b984d1677a:1
  • value  3393
    address  2NAiFFV988qWAMRFwArT2rNe2uz6Y8TgoC8